    What science fiction movie was billed as "the ultimate trip"?

    2001 : A Space Odyssey

    It was given this tagline, because the "trip" concerned human evolution. The monolith placed on Earth speeded up evolution in prehistory and the one found on the moon start a race to the moons of Jupiter - the prize being the next step in evolution.

    More cynically, it could be argued that the visualisation of astronaut David Bowman's journey from the Monolith orbiting Jupiter to a mocked-up hotel room many light-years from the Solar System resembles nothing so much as a psychedelic light-show, and it is on record that hippies and other drug-users would often go to the cinema to watch this segment while stoned.

    "While '2001' is certainly not responsible for the LSD fad that was hitting America at the time, the movie's contents encouraged drug use in movie theaters. Theater managers were at their wits ends trying to halt the marihuana smoking in theater balconies." Emanuel Levy, 2008
